Mechanism of Action Buprenorphine and methadone engage with the same neural receptors as traditional opioids, but their actions diverge. Methadone is a full agonist, activating these receptors fully and curbing cravings and withdrawal symptoms. Buprenorphine, however, operates as a partial agonist. It triggers these receptors partially, resulting in controlled effects that alleviate withdrawal symptoms without producing the same intense euphoria as traditional opioids. Administration and Accessibility A critical disparity lies in the administration and accessibility of these medications. Methadone is predominantly dispensed in specialized clinics due to its potential for misuse and overdose. Individuals receiving methadone must often visit these clinics daily for observed dosing. Conversely, buprenorphine offers a more versatile approach. Healthcare providers qualified for opioid addiction treatment can prescribe buprenorphine for at-home use, enhancing patient autonomy and diminishing the burden of frequent clinic visits. Withdrawal and Tapering When individuals discontinue these medications, the dissimilarities come to the forefront. Methadone withdrawal is characterized by its prolonged and intense nature, owing to its extended half-life. The severity of symptoms can pose challenges to sustained abstinence. Buprenorphine withdrawal, with its shorter half-life, tends to be less severe and more manageable. Additionally, the ceiling effect of buprenorphine can simplify tapering off the medication, making the transition smoother for patients. Risk of Abuse and Overdose Addressing addiction involves mitigating the risk of abuse and overdose associated with these medications. Methadone's status as a full agonist places it at a higher risk for abuse, as its effects can induce euphoria akin to traditional opioids. Strict clinic administration helps curb this potential. Buprenorphine's partial agonist nature and ceiling effect render it less prone to abuse and overdose. It relieves cravings and withdrawal without instigating the same level of euphoria. Pregnancy and Treatment Considering the safety of these medications during pregnancy is paramount, given the unique challenges expectant mothers face with opioid addiction. Methadone, with extensive research supporting its use, has been a mainstay in pregnant individuals seeking treatment. Buprenorphine has also emerged as a viable option due to its milder withdrawal profile and reduced risk of neonatal abstinence syndrome. Both medications require careful medical supervision during pregnancy to ensure the health of both mother and child. Individualization and Flexibility A standout feature of buprenorphine is its adaptability and customization. Available in various formulations, such as sublingual tablets, patches, and implants, it allows treatment plans to be tailored to individual needs. Methadone's more regimented administration model limits these customization options.
